							- "use strict";
 
- /**
 
-  * A base class for all document sources
 
-  * @class DocumentSource
 
-  * @namespace mungedb-aggregate.pipeline.documentSources
 
-  * @module mungedb-aggregate
 
-  * @constructor
 
-  * @param expCtx  {ExpressionContext}
 
-  **/
 
- var DocumentSource = module.exports = function DocumentSource(expCtx){
 
- 	if(arguments.length !== 1) throw new Error("one arg expected");
 
- 	/*
 
- 	* Most DocumentSources have an underlying source they get their data
 
- 	* from.  This is a convenience for them.
 
- 	* The default implementation of setSource() sets this; if you don't
 
- 	* need a source, override that to verify().  The default is to
 
- 	* verify() if this has already been set.
 
- 	*/
 
- 	this.source = null;
 
- 	/*
 
- 	* The zero-based user-specified pipeline step.  Used for diagnostics.
 
- 	* Will be set to -1 for artificial pipeline steps that were not part
 
- 	* of the original user specification.
 
- 	*/
 
- 	this.step = -1;
 
- 	this.expCtx = expCtx || {};
 
- 	/*
 
- 	*  for explain: # of rows returned by this source
 
- 	*  This is *not* unsigned so it can be passed to JSONObjBuilder.append().
 
- 	*/
 
- 	this.nRowsOut = 0;
 
- }, klass = DocumentSource, base = Object, proto = klass.prototype = Object.create(base.prototype, {constructor:{value:klass}});

- /**
 
-  * Set the step for a user-specified pipeline step.
 
-  * @method	setPipelineStep
 
-  * @param	{Number}	step	number 0 to n.
 
-  **/
 
- proto.setPipelineStep = function setPipelineStep(step) {
 
- 	this.step = step;
 
- };
 
- /**
 
-  * Get the user-specified pipeline step.
 
-  * @method	getPipelineStep
 
-  * @returns	{Number}	step
 
-  **/
 
- proto.getPipelineStep = function getPipelineStep() {
 
- 	return this.step;
 
- };
 
- /**
 
-  * Is the source at EOF?
 
-  * @method	eof
 
-  **/
 
- proto.eof = function eof() {
 
- 	throw new Error("not implemented");
 
- };
 
- /**
 
-  * Advance the state of the DocumentSource so that it will return the next Document.
 
-  * The default implementation returns false, after checking for interrupts.
 
-  * Derived classes can call the default implementation in their own implementations in order to check for interrupts.
 
-  *
 
-  * @method	advance
 
-  * @returns	{Boolean}	whether there is another document to fetch, i.e., whether or not getCurrent() will succeed.  This default implementation always returns false.
 
-  **/
 
- proto.advance = function advance() {
 
- 	//pExpCtx->checkForInterrupt(); // might not return
 
- 	return false;
 
- };
 
- /**
 
-  * some implementations do the equivalent of verify(!eof()) so check eof() first
 
-  * @method	getCurrent
 
-  * @returns	{Document}	the current Document without advancing
 
-  **/
 
- proto.getCurrent = function getCurrent() {
 
- 	throw new Error("not implemented");
 
- };
 
- /**
 
-  * Inform the source that it is no longer needed and may release its resources.  After
 
-  * dispose() is called the source must still be able to handle iteration requests, but may
 
-  * become eof().
 
-  * NOTE: For proper mutex yielding, dispose() must be called on any DocumentSource that will
 
-  * not be advanced until eof(), see SERVER-6123.
 
-  *
 
-  * @method	dispose
 
-  **/
 
- proto.dispose = function dispose() {
 
- 	if ( this.source ) {
 
- 		// This is required for the DocumentSourceCursor to release its read lock, see
 
- 		// SERVER-6123.
 
- 		this.source.dispose();
 
- 	}
 
- };
 
- /**
 
-  * Get the source's name.
 
-  * @method	getSourceName
 
-  * @returns	{String}	the string name of the source as a constant string; this is static, and there's no need to worry about adopting it
 
-  **/
 
- proto.getSourceName = function getSourceName() {
 
- 	return "[UNKNOWN]";
 
- };
 
- /**
 
-  * Set the underlying source this source should use to get Documents
 
-  * from.
 
-  * It is an error to set the source more than once.  This is to
 
-  * prevent changing sources once the original source has been started;
 
-  * this could break the state maintained by the DocumentSource.
 
-  * This pointer is not reference counted because that has led to
 
-  * some circular references.  As a result, this doesn't keep
 
-  * sources alive, and is only intended to be used temporarily for
 
-  * the lifetime of a Pipeline::run().
 
-  *
 
-  * @method	setSource
 
-  * @param	{DocumentSource}	source	the underlying source to use
 
-  **/
 
- proto.setSource = function setSource(theSource, callback) {
 
- 	if (this.source) throw new Error("It is an error to set the source more than once");
 
- 	this.source = theSource;
 
- 	if (callback) return setTimeout(callback, 0);
 
- };
 
- /**
 
-  * Attempt to coalesce this DocumentSource with its successor in the
 
-  * document processing pipeline.  If successful, the successor
 
-  * DocumentSource should be removed from the pipeline and discarded.
 
-  * If successful, this operation can be applied repeatedly, in an
 
-  * attempt to coalesce several sources together.
 
-  * The default implementation is to do nothing, and return false.
 
-  *
 
-  * @method	coalesce
 
-  * @param	{DocumentSource}	nextSource	the next source in the document processing chain.
 
-  * @returns	{Boolean}	whether or not the attempt to coalesce was successful or not; if the attempt was not successful, nothing has been changed
 
-  **/
 
- proto.coalesce = function coalesce(nextSource) {
 
- 	return false;
 
- };
 
- /**
 
-  * Optimize the pipeline operation, if possible.  This is a local
 
-  * optimization that only looks within this DocumentSource.  For best
 
-  * results, first coalesce compatible sources using coalesce().
 
-  * This is intended for any operations that include expressions, and
 
-  * provides a hook for those to optimize those operations.
 
-  * The default implementation is to do nothing.
 
-  *
 
-  * @method	optimize
 
-  **/
 
- proto.optimize = function optimize() {
 
- };
 
- klass.GetDepsReturn = {
 
- 	NOT_SUPPORTED: "NOT_SUPPORTED", // This means the set should be ignored
 
- 	EXHAUSTIVE: "EXHAUSTIVE", // This means that everything needed should be in the set
 
- 	SEE_NEXT: "SEE_NEXT" // Add the next Source's deps to the set
 
- };
 
- /**
 
-  * Get the fields this operation needs to do its job.
 
-  * Deps should be in "a.b.c" notation
 
-  *
 
-  * @method	getDependencies
 
-  * @param	{Object} deps	set (unique array) of strings
 
-  * @returns	DocumentSource.GetDepsReturn
 
-  **/
 
- proto.getDependencies = function getDependencies(deps) {
 
- 	return klass.GetDepsReturn.NOT_SUPPORTED;
 
- };
 
- /**
 
-  * This takes dependencies from getDependencies and
 
-  * returns a projection that includes all of them
 
-  *
 
-  * @method	depsToProjection
 
-  * @param	{Object} deps	set (unique array) of strings
 
-  * @returns	{Object}	JSONObj
 
-  **/
 
- klass.depsToProjection = function depsToProjection(deps) {
 
- 	var bb = {};
 
- 	if (deps._id === undefined)
 
- 		bb._id = 0;
 
- 	var last = "";
 
- 	Object.keys(deps).sort().forEach(function(it){
 
- 		if (last !== "" && it.slice(0, last.length) === last){
 
- 			// we are including a parent of *it so we don't need to
 
- 			// include this field explicitly. In fact, due to
 
- 			// SERVER-6527 if we included this field, the parent
 
- 			// wouldn't be fully included.
 
- 			return;
 
- 		}
 
- 		last = it + ".";
 
- 		bb[it] = 1;
 
- 	});
 
- 	return bb;
 
- };
 
- /**
 
-  * Add the DocumentSource to the array builder.
 
-  * The default implementation calls sourceToJson() in order to
 
-  * convert the inner part of the object which will be added to the
 
-  * array being built here.
 
-  *
 
-  * @method	addToJsonArray
 
-  * @param	{Array} pBuilder	JSONArrayBuilder: the array builder to add the operation to.
 
-  * @param	{Boolean}	explain	create explain output
 
-  * @returns	{Object}
 
-  **/
 
- proto.addToJsonArray = function addToJsonArray(pBuilder, explain) {
 
- 	pBuilder.push(this.sourceToJson({}, explain));
 
- };
 
- /**
 
-  * Create an object that represents the document source.  The object
 
-  * will have a single field whose name is the source's name.  This
 
-  * will be used by the default implementation of addToJsonArray()
 
-  * to add this object to a pipeline being represented in JSON.
 
-  *
 
-  * @method	sourceToJson
 
-  * @param	{Object} pBuilder	JSONObjBuilder: a blank object builder to write to
 
-  * @param	{Boolean}	explain	create explain output
 
-  **/
 
- proto.sourceToJson = function sourceToJson(pBuilder, explain) {
 
- 	throw new Error("not implemented");
 
- };
 
- /**
 
-  * Convert the DocumentSource instance to it's JSON Object representation; Used by the standard JSON.stringify() function
 
-  * @method toJSON
 
-  * @return {String} a JSON-encoded String that represents the DocumentSource
 
-  **/
 
- proto.toJSON = function toJSON(){
 
- 	var obj = {};
 
- 	this.sourceToJson(obj);
 
- 	return obj;
 
- };
